Manukyan refuses to plead guilty to coup d'etat calls

The Investigative Committee of Armenia charged Vazgen Manukyan, a candidate for prime minister from the Armenian opposition, for calling to overthrow the government and then obliged him to sign recognizance not to leave. The oppositionist denied the accusations brought against him by the investigators.

The "Caucasian Knot" has reported that on March 3, straight at a rally, Vazgen Manukyan, the candidate for prime minister from the opposition "Movement to Save the Motherland", got a summons stating that after his speech at a rally on February 20, a criminal case had been instituted against him under the article on calling to overthrow the government.

Today, Vazgen Manukyan has been summoned for an interrogation at the Investigative Committee of Armenia, where he was charged under Article 301 "Public calls for seizing power, violating territorial integrity or violent overthrow of the constitutional order" of the Criminal Code of Armenia, reports an officer of the press service for the Investigative Committee of Armenia. "A recognizance not to leave has been chosen as a pre-trial restriction measure against Vazgen Manukyan," the "Caucasian Knot" correspondent learned from the Investigative Committee's press officer.

Vazgen Manukyan said that he did not admit the charges brought against him and called the criminal case a political persecution. According to the opposition politician's version, there are no violations of the law in his appeals. "This is a nationwide appeal, since the society demands the Nikol Pashinyan's resignation. And I'm only one of those who voiced the demand," Vazgen Manukyan said.
